3. Angle Buried

For a good while during the Attitude Era, Kurt Angle was on a level with Triple H and “Stone Cold” Steve Austin. He later battled Shawn Michaels toe-to-toe and faced off against the Undertaker.

One thing you can unequivocally say about all these other legends and Hall-of-Famers… they’d never lose a match to Baron Corbin in under 10 minutes. That’s not to advocate for nearly 50-year-old legends to start beating up the next generation of superstars, but you don’t see Triple H or Undertaker get humiliated on Raw like this. They’re treated like deities in the ring.

Angle, meanwhile, has been decimated by Drew McIntyre (understandable), tossed from the Royal Rumble in short order (disappointing) and lost a revenge match against Corbin cleanly.

Perhaps this is leading to a redemption angle for Kurt, but it better come soon, because he’ll be jobbing to another Curt (Hawkins) soon enough.
